Women's National Collegiate Athletic Association

The Women's National Collegiate Athletic Association (WNCAA) is an athletic association in the Philippines exclusively for women. It was founded in 1970. Competition is divided into three divisions: Seniors for college students, Juniors for high school students, and Midgets for grade school and first year high school students. Its men's counterpart is the Men's National Collegiate Athletic Association, founded in 2004.

The Season 48 of the WNCAA was started on September 2, 2017, with the opening ceremonies featuring former Ateneo De Manila University star player Alyssa Valdez as the guest speaker following the tripleheader in Basketball held at the Philippine Sports Commission former Ultra. St. Pedro Poveda College was named as the host.[1]
